Stillwater, Saratoga County
Rita Baker passed away on Wednesday, December 9, 2015 at Saratoga Center in Ballston Spa. She was 93.
Born in St. Aubins, Vermont on April 28, 1922, daughter of the late Clifford and Mabel Sabin. Rita was predeceased by her husband, Earl Baker and her sister Pauline S. Hinchey, brother in laws Edward F. Hinchey and Robert Baker.
As a child, she and her family moved to Mechanicville. Rita graduated from Mechanicville High School and Mildred Elley School. She worked for the NYS Education Department for over 20 years. She later worked for the NYS Department of Correction. Returning to work in Mechanicville, Rita was employed by Lynd Brousseau Insurance for many years.
After retirement, Rita moved to Stillwater. She loved all animals, especially her poodles which she trained and entered in many dog shows around the state and surrounding areas, winning many blue ribbons. Some of her many friends, with their dogs joined her, making fun and exciting times for all. Rita was a kind, loving and fun person to be around. Rita was an avid NY Yankees Fan and she cherished her Yorkie, Kaitlyn. She spent many happy years with her beloved companion William Wheelock. She is survived by her sister in law Grace Baker and her niece Alice Nash (Darrin) and she will be especially missed by her friends Stephanie Hebert, Kathryn Powers, Patricia Russom, Bert Mang as well as many others.
